Kontribusi Lingkungan Keluarga dan Sekolah terhadap Minat Studi Ke Perguruan Tinggi Siswa Kelas XI Program Keahlian Teknik Pemesinan di SMK Negeri 1 Padang Tahun 2025 Muhammad Ivan Febrian; Jasman; Eko Indrawan; Remon Lapisa

Abstract

Penelitian ini bertujuan untuk menganalisis kontribusi lingkungan keluarga dan lingkungan sekolah terhadap minat studi ke perguruan tinggi pada siswa kelas XI Program Keahlian Teknik Pemesinan di SMK Negeri 1 Padang tahun ajaran 2025/2026, yang didorong oleh fenomena fluktuasi minat lulusan untuk melanjutkan pendidikan. Jenis penelitian ini adalah kuantitatif dengan metode regresi linier berganda yang melibatkan 50 siswa sebagai responden melalui teknik sensus sampling. Instrumen penelitian berupa kuesioner dengan skala Likert yang telah teruji validitas dan reliabilitasnya, kemudian data diolah menggunakan perangkat lunak SPSS. Hasil penelitian menunjukkan bahwa secara parsial, variabel lingkungan keluarga berkontribusi signifikan terhadap minat studi dengan nilai t hitung 4,563, begitu pula dengan lingkungan sekolah yang memberikan kontribusi signifikan dengan nilai t hitung 2,375. Secara simultan, kedua variabel tersebut memberikan kontribusi sebesar 62,2% terhadap minat siswa melanjutkan studi ke perguruan tinggi, dengan persamaan regresi Y = -23,339 + 0,665X₁ + 0,515X₂. Hal ini menunjukkan bahwa semakin kondusif dukungan keluarga dan atmosfer sekolah, maka semakin tinggi minat siswa untuk melanjutkan pendidikan ke jenjang yang lebih tinggi, sementara 37,8% lainnya dipengaruhi oleh faktor-faktor lain di luar lingkup penelitian ini.
Pengaruh Penggunaan Media Pembelajaran Turbin Air Model Vortex terhadap Hasil Belajar Mahasiswa pada Mata Kuliah Mesin Konversi Energi Dwi Ari Septiawan; Dori Yuvenda; Purwantono; Eko Indrawan

Abstract

Penelitian ini bertujuan untuk menganalisis pengaruh penggunaan media pembelajaran turbin air model vortex terhadap hasil belajar mahasiswa pada mata kuliah Mesin Konversi Energi. Penelitian ini menggunakan metode kuantitatif dengan pendekatan quasi experiment dan desain nonequivalent control group design. Subjek penelitian terdiri atas 75 mahasiswa semester V angkatan 2023 yang terbagi ke dalam kelas eksperimen dan kelas kontrol. Kelas eksperimen menggunakan media pembelajaran turbin air model vortex, sedangkan kelas kontrol menggunakan media pembelajaran konvensional berupa power point. Instrumen penelitian berupa tes objektif pilihan ganda yang diberikan dalam bentuk pretest dan posttest. Data dianalisis menggunakan uji normalitas, uji homogenitas, dan uji hipotesis menggunakan uji-t. Hasil penelitian menunjukkan bahwa nilai rata-rata kelas eksperimen meningkat dari 71 menjadi 84 dengan ketuntasan belajar sebesar 92%, sedangkan kelas kontrol meningkat dari 73 menjadi 80,84 dengan ketuntasan sebesar 84%. Hasil uji-t menunjukkan nilai signifikansi 0,000 < 0,05, sehingga dapat disimpulkan bahwa penggunaan media pembelajaran turbin air model vortex berpengaruh signifikan terhadap peningkatan hasil belajar mahasiswa.
Pengaruh Persepsi Mahasiswa tentang Profesi Guru terhadap Minat menjadi Guru pada Mahasiswa Pendidikan Teknik Mesin Universitas Negeri Padang Muhamad Fadel; Jasman Jasman; Eko Indrawan; Budi Syahri

Abstract

Although the teaching profession has a strategic role in ensuring the quality of vocational education, not all students in education study programs show a strong interest in pursuing a career as teachers. This study aims to analyze the effect of students’ perceptions of the teaching profession on interest in becoming teachers among students of the Mechanical Engineering Education Study Program at Universitas Negeri Padang. This study used a quantitative approach with an associative ex post facto design. The population as well as the research sample consisted of 72 students from the 2022 cohort, determined through a total sampling technique. Data were collected using a four-point Likert-scale questionnaire distributed through Google Forms. The research instrument consisted of 35 valid items with a Cronbach’s Alpha reliability coefficient of 0.949. Data were analyzed using descriptive statistics, normality testing, linearity testing, and simple linear regression with the assistance of SPSS. The results showed that students’ perceptions of the teaching profession were in the good category, with the largest percentage of 36%, while interest in becoming teachers was also in the good category, with the largest percentage of 44%. The regression analysis produced the equation Y = 10.348 + 0.448X, while the t-test obtained a value of 4.718 with a significance of 0.000 < 0.05. These findings indicate that students’ perceptions of the teaching profession have a positive and significant effect on interest in becoming teachers. The conclusion of this study affirms that the more positive students’ perceptions of the teaching profession, the higher their interest in choosing a teaching career. The implications of this study emphasize the importance of strengthening understanding, experience, and a positive image of the teaching profession in vocational education programs so that students’ interest in becoming teachers can develop more optimally.
Enhanced durability and tribological performance of polyvinyl alcohol/layered double hydroxide/tannic acid composites under repeated swelling cycles Dieter Rahmadiawan; Shih-Chen Shi; Wei-Ting Zhuang; Eko Indrawan; Yolli Fernanda; Budi Syahri; Irzal Irzal

Abstract

In recent years, the exploration of polyvinyl alcohol (PVA) composites has garnered significant attention due to their versatility applications in aqueous environments. However, despite their promise, neat PVA exhibit limitations such as significant mechanical degradation under repeated swelling cycles. This study investigates the durability and tribological performance of polyvinyl alcohol (PVA) composites reinforced with nickel-iron layered double hydroxide (LDH) and tannic acid (TA) under repeated swelling cycles. Building on previous research that explored composite preparation and initial characterization, this research emphasizes the effects of cyclic swelling on wear resistance, friction behavior, and mechanical properties. Tribological tests were conducted to evaluate the coefficient of friction (COF) and wear rate before and after multiple swelling cycles, alongside tensile strength and strain measurements. The results revealed that the PVA/TA2/LDH2 composite, containing the highest additive content, exhibited the lowest wear rate of 11.52 × 10⁻⁵ mm³/Nm after 3 swelling cycles, demonstrating superior resistance to material degradation. Although PVA/TA2/LDH1 exhibited a slightly lower COF, its wear rate was higher due to reduced reinforcement. Compared to neat PVA, which showed a COF increase from 0.45 to 0.53, the PVA/LDH/TA composites retained their tribological stability, with only a marginal increase in COF and wear rate. Similarly, tensile strength of PVA/TA2/LDH2 decreased by only 11% after 3 cycles (from 33.3 MPa to 30 MPa), while neat PVA experienced a 25.5% reduction (from 30 MPa to 22.5 MPa). These findings highlight the potential of PVA/LDH/TA composites for applications in aqueous environments, offering significantly enhanced long-term performance and reliability.
Trends in anti-UV films or composites: A bibliometric study Dieter Rahmadiawan; Thiago F. Santos; Navid Aslfattahi; Shih-Chen Shi; Eko Indrawan; Athaya Ramadhan; Zainal Abadi

Abstract

Anti-UV films and composites play a critical role in protecting materials from ultraviolet-induced degradation, which can weaken polymers, reduce product lifespan, and compromise performance in sectors such as food packaging, outdoor coatings, and biomedical devices. The growing emphasis on sustainability and the need for environmentally friendly protective materials have further accelerated research on UV-shielding technologies that incorporate biopolymers, multifunctional additives, and renewable resources. This study presents a comprehensive bibliometric analysis of global research on anti-UV films and composites over the period 2014–2024. Data were retrieved from the Scopus database and analyzed using Bibliometrix (R package) and VOSviewer were employed to analyze publication patterns, map keyword networks, and visualize thematic evolution, as these tools enable robust quantitative and structural mapping of large bibliographic datasets. Three dominant thematic clusters were identified: (i) nanoparticle-based UV shielding using inorganic fillers such as ZnO and TiO₂, (ii) multifunctional films integrating UV protection with antibacterial and antioxidant properties, and (iii) biopolymer-based matrices emphasizing mechanical durability and environmental sustainability. These clusters highlight the convergence of performance, sustainability, and multifunctionality as key drivers shaping current research directions. Despite significant progress, the analysis reveals limited attention to scalability, industrial compatibility, and long-term performance evaluation. The findings underscore the need for future research to incorporate pilot-scale processing, life-cycle assessments, and interdisciplinary collaboration to bridge the gap between laboratory formulations and commercial implementation. Overall, this bibliometric study provides a consolidated understanding of the evolution and research landscape of anti-UV films and composites.
Problem-based learning in orthogonal projection drawing: A quasi-experimental study on vocational machining students’ technical drawing achievement Aprilia Eka Salwa; Syahril Syahril; Eko Indrawan; Gulzhaina K. Kassymova

Abstract

This study examined the implementation of Problem-Based Learning (PBL) and its effect on Grade X Machining Engineering students’ cognitive achievement in Technical Drawing, particularly orthogonal projection. The study used a quantitative quasi-experimental design with a non-equivalent control group. The participants were 70 students at SMK Negeri 5 Padang, divided into an experimental class taught using PBL and a control class taught using conventional instruction. Data were collected through pretest and post-test scores using a validated multiple-choice test on orthogonal projection. The final instrument consisted of 28 valid items with a KR-20 reliability coefficient of 0.914. Descriptive statistics, Shapiro-Wilk normality tests, Levene’s homogeneity test, and an independent samples t-test were used for data analysis. The results showed that both groups improved after instruction, but the experimental class achieved a higher increase. The mean score of the experimental class rose from 53.57 to 79.28, while the control class increased from 53.67 to 64.29. The t-test showed a significant post-test difference between groups, t (68) = -10.152, p < 0.001. These findings indicate that PBL supports stronger cognitive achievement in orthogonal projection learning by engaging students in investigation, discussion, presentation, and evaluation. The findings directly recommend PBL for visual technical topics in vocational classrooms.
Training quality and work motivation predict vocational high school teacher performance effectively Marliza Deviana; Eko Indrawan; Ika Parma Dewi; Jonni Mardizal

Abstract

This study examined the effects of Training Quality and Work Motivation on Teacher Performance among vocational high school teachers. A quantitative explanatory survey was conducted involving all 31 teachers at SMKN 7 Sijunjung using a census sampling technique. Data were collected through a structured questionnaire and analyzed using Partial Least Squares Structural Equation Modeling (PLS-SEM) with SmartPLS 4.1.0.8. The measurement model demonstrated satisfactory reliability and validity. Training Quality had the strongest positive effect on Teacher Performance (β = 0.646, p < 0.001), followed by Work Motivation (β = 0.416, p < 0.001). Together, both variables explained 64.9% of the variance in Teacher Performance (R² = 0.649). Enhancing teacher performance requires integrating high-quality professional development with strategies that strengthen teachers' work motivation
